In a surprising turn of events, the Golden State Warriors chose not to draft Bronny James during the recent NBA draft, despite his talent and potential. Reports indicate that the Warriors, who had Bronny on their draft board and appreciated his skill set, decided to pass on him to honor the wishes of his father, LeBron James, the star player for the Los Angeles Lakers. This decision reflects the longstanding respect the Warriors have for LeBron and his influence in the league.

Ultimately, Bronny was selected by the Lakers as the 55th overall pick, making him the first son to join his father in the NBA. This momentous pairing is something LeBron has openly desired for years, expressing his wish to play alongside Bronny before retiring. The 19-year-old guard had a challenging collegiate career at USC, particularly after facing a cardiac incident that sidelined him for the beginning of the season. Though his stats were modest—averaging just 4.8 points, 2.8 rebounds, and 2.1 assists per game—his determination to enter the draft speaks volumes about his ambition.

The Warriors’ decision not to select Bronny at the 52nd pick has sparked considerable debate among fans and analysts. Many believe that selecting Bronny could have been a strategic move not only to bolster their roster but also to entice LeBron into considering a future with Golden State. Such speculation was fueled by the fact that LeBron had not yet signed a new contract with the Lakers and could have tested the free agency waters. The prospect of LeBron playing alongside his son and teaming up with another superstar, Stephen Curry, would have certainly created waves in the league.

In the days leading up to the draft, there were whispers that Bronny’s agent, Rich Paul, was advising teams against selecting him, suggesting that he would opt to play in Australia instead. This maneuver, aimed at ensuring Bronny would land with the Lakers, highlights the intricate dynamics at play in this year's draft. It raises questions about the impact of family connections in professional sports and how those relationships can influence decisions made by franchises.

As the preseason approaches, the Lakers are set to face the Warriors twice, creating an exciting narrative as fans anticipate the opportunity to see the James father-son duo in action against one of the league's premier teams. In training camp, reports indicate Bronny has been holding his own, even making some impressive shots over his father, which should only add to the intrigue surrounding their on-court chemistry.
